In second airstrikes in two days, IDF hit T4 airbase and Iranian missile depot, five killed; Nasrallah attacks America, Deal of the Century, claims: We will respond directly and forcefully to any Israeli attack on sites or facilities of the organization in Lebanese territory.
Israel carried out additional airstrikes in Syria on Sunday, targeting a T4 airbase with Iranian missile depots in Homs. A reported five were killed, two of which were Syrian soldiers. The strikes reportedly hit the base, destroyed a transfer vehicle and an Iranian Revolutionary Guards missile depot. The strikes followed two rocket attacks on Mt. Hermon from Syria on Saturday after which the Israel Defense Forces (IDF) retaliated hitting numerous Iranian, Hezbollah and Syrian army sites. While the IDF confirmed Saturday’s events, it did not respond to reports on yesterday’s airstrikes, consistent with the majority of covert operations in Syria and Lebanon.
The IDF continues to combat Iran’s entrenchment and efforts in Syria and through its proxies in the region. Prime Minister Netanyahu specifically addressed Iran’s massive funding of its proxy Hezbollah in Lebanon on Sunday night. He stated, “Iran transfers $700 million to Hezbollah per annum. But it does so by various methods, including fraud. In this framework, the Iranian Foreign Ministry transfers over $100 million to terrorist organizations. The money is transferred under diplomatic cover, by seemingly innocent means, to Lebanon and from there to Hezbollah.” Again exposing Iran, the prime minister added, “These enormous amounts fuel the relentless aggression by Iran and its proxies in our region. Our neighbors know it; all of the Arab states know it. This is one of the things that is bringing them to a renewed closeness with us.”
He reiterated that Israel will respond to Iran’s threats and that the Jewish state is not “deterred by them because anyone who tries to hurt us will be hurt far worse.” Referring to Israel’s strikes in Syria on Saturday and its commemoration of the Six Day War and its liberation of Jerusalem, he boasted, “We have proven this many times in the history of our state. We proved it just last night. We proved it in the six remarkable days that brought us back to parts of our ancient homeland.”
Hezbollah head Hassan Nasrallah on Sunday directly threatened the State of Israel, giving an address during Quds Day. He spoke of war with Iran as resulting in “the whole region will erupt”, threatening “any American forces and American interests will be permissible as a target.” Further criticizing the United States and its efforts and alliances in the region, he added, “The goal of the “Deal of the Century” is to strengthen Israel’s presence and eliminate the Palestinian issue; this is a false deal and the axis of resistance will prevent it from materializing… The Americans have no business with this. It is our right to have weapons to defend our countries and it is our right to manufacture any weapons.”
Nasrallah further threatened Israel, stating “We will respond directly and forcefully to any Israeli attack on sites or facilities of the organization in Lebanese territory.”
